Suruli Falls Best Place for a Relaxing Trip is a beautiful waterfall located near Cumbum in the Theni district of Tamil Nadu. Surrounded by green forests and hills, it is a popular tourist spot for nature lovers and families. The falls are also known for their spiritual and cultural importance, making them a perfect place for relaxation and exploration.

Suruli Falls History

While most people visit Suruli Falls for its natural beauty, the place also has a rich history that makes it even more special.

Ancient References in Literature

Suruli Falls is a natural wonder and a part of Tamil literature. It is mentioned in the famous Tamil epic Silappathikaram, written around the 2nd century AD. The poem describes Suruli as a “cloud-like” waterfall, showing that it was admired even in ancient times. This makes Suruli Falls a tourist spot and a cultural heritage site.

Connection with Temples and Caves

The area around Suruli Falls is also known for its old caves and temples. The Kailasanathar Cave Temple, located nearby, is carved into rocks and reflects the architectural skills of earlier times. These caves are said to have been built during the 11th century by the Pandya kings. Many saints and sages are believed to have meditated in this peaceful environment.

Mythological Importance

Local legends say that the water of Suruli Falls has healing powers. People believe bathing in the falls can refresh the body and mind. The natural beauty and spiritual beliefs make the falls an essential place for pilgrims and tourists.

Suruli Falls in Modern Times

Today, Suruli Falls is a well-known picnic spot. The Tamil Nadu Tourism Department has developed facilities for visitors. Every year, thousands of people come here to enjoy the calm waters, explore the caves, and connect with the history of this waterfall.

About Suruli Falls

The Suruli River flows down from the Meghamalai hills and forms this stunning waterfall. The water falls from about 150 feet, creating a refreshing and peaceful environment. There are also caves near the falls with ancient paintings and carvings, adding historical value to this natural wonder Suruli Falls Best Place for a Relaxing Trip.

Suruli Falls Timing

Suruli Falls is open to visitors every day. The usual visiting hours are:

  • Opening Time: 8:00 AM
  • Closing Time: 5:00 PM

Visiting the falls during the day with enough sunlight and safety arrangements is best. Early morning or before evening is the perfect time to enjoy the natural beauty and cool breeze.

Best Time to Visit

During the monsoon season, the best time to visit Suruli Falls is between June and October. The waterfall is full of water during this time, and the surrounding forest looks fresh and green.

How to Reach Suruli Falls

By Air

The nearest airport is Madurai Airport, about 125 km away. You can hire a taxi or take a bus from the airport to Suruli Falls.

By Train

The closest railway station is Theni Railway Station, located around 56 km from the falls. Another option is Madurai Junction, which has better train connectivity. Buses and taxis are available to reach the falls from these stations.

By Road

Suruli Falls is well-connected by road. You can travel by:

  • Bus: Regular buses are available from Theni, Cumbum, and Madurai.
  • Car/Taxi: You can hire a car or taxi for a more comfortable trip. The roads leading to the falls pass through scenic villages and hills, making the drive enjoyable Suruli Falls Best Place for a Relaxing Trip.

Suruli Falls Distance from Major Cities

  • The Theni – Suruli Falls is about 56 km away. It takes around 1.5 hours by road.
  • From Madurai – The distance is about 123 km, and it takes around 3 hours to reach.
  • From Thekkady (Kerala) – It is just 20 km away, so many tourists from Kerala visit here easily.
  • From Chennai – The distance is around 540 km, and the best way is to travel by train or bus to Theni and then by road.

Suruli Falls Nearby Attractions

While the waterfall is stunning, many nearby attractions make your trip even more special.

1. Suruli Caves

Close to Suruli Falls, you can explore the ancient Suruli Caves. These caves have beautiful rock formations and a peaceful atmosphere. They are also connected to old stories and legends, making them a must-visit for history lovers.

2. Kumbakkarai Falls

Another natural beauty near Suruli Falls is Kumbakkarai Falls. It is less crowded and gives you a chance to enjoy nature quietly. The fresh water and scenic views make it a relaxing place for families.

3. Meghamalai Hills

Also known as the “High Wavy Mountains,” Meghamalai Hills is a nearby hill station with tea plantations, wildlife, and cool weather. It is perfect for people who love trekking, photography, and peaceful holidays.

4. Thekkady (Periyar Wildlife Sanctuary)

Located near Suruli Falls, Thekkady in Kerala is famous for the Periyar Wildlife Sanctuary. Here, you can enjoy boating in the lake and spot elephants, deer, and birds. It is one of the top attractions near Suruli Falls for wildlife lovers.

5. Vaigai Dam

Vaigai Dam is another tourist spot you can visit on your way. It is surrounded by a beautiful garden where families can spend time. In the evenings, the view of the dam is charming.

6. Cumbum Valley

Known for its vineyards and farmlands, Cumbum Valley is a peaceful spot near Suruli Falls. You can see grape farms, taste fresh fruits, and enjoy the natural scenery.
